Acquiring Auto Parts in Pakistan: A Guideline
The auto industry in Pakistan is thriving and a key part of its growth relies on the availability of high-quality auto parts. While local production has expanded, there are still specific parts and specialized components that need to be imported from international markets. This article provides a detailed guide of the process involved in importing auto parts into Pakistan, helping you navigate the procedures and ensure a smooth deal.
- First identifying your specific requirements. Determine the exact type of part required, including its dimensions. This will help you locate the right suppliers globally.
- Subsequently, conduct thorough investigation to find potential suppliers who specialize in the required auto parts. Online directories, industry magazines, and trade exhibitions can be valuable assets for this purpose.
- Once a few potential suppliers, request estimates from them. Compare the prices, delivery times, and payment terms to make an informed decision.
- Upon placing an order, ensure that you understand the import policies in Pakistan. Seek advice from the relevant government authorities, such as the Customs Department, to clarify any doubts or requirements.
At last, upon arrival of your shipment at Pakistani ports, you will need to handle customs formalities. This may involve submitting documents and paying applicable import duties and taxes. Stay informed about the latest amendments in import regulations to ensure a smooth and compliant importation process.
Challenges Facing Pakistan's Auto Parts Industry
The Pakistani auto parts industry is facing a range of problems. One major problem is the rising cost of inputs, which has been fueled by global economic conditions. Furthermore, pressure from international auto parts is strong, making it hard for local manufacturers to remain viable.
The industry also faces with lack of access to funding, which slows down its potential to invest in its technology. Furthermore, a shortage of skilled labor is a major challenge.
These issues have resulted in a decline in the growth of the auto parts industry in Pakistan.
Local vs Imported Auto Parts Showdown in Pakistan
In the bustling automotive market of here Pakistan, a constant debate rages between fans of local and imported auto parts. Each side presents compelling arguments, fueling a fierce competition that influences the industry landscape. Local parts, often crafted with domestic resources, boast low prices. They present a accessible source for repairs and servicing, catering to the demands of Pakistan's vast car fleet.
On the other hand, imported auto parts guarantee a higher quality of components, often obtained from renowned brands globally. This can result in enhanced performance, durability, and dependability.
- Yet, the higher cost of imported parts can be a deterrent for many car owners in Pakistan.
- Additionally, issues related to stock and border control can create difficulty for those seeking imported parts.
Ultimately, the choice between local and imported auto parts in Pakistan is a subjective one. It depends on factors such as budget, preferences, and vehicle type.

Pakistan's Growing Need for Premium Auto Parts
Pakistan's automotive industry is experiencing a period of substantial growth, driven by factors such as increasing disposable incomes and a burgeoning middle class. This surge in vehicle ownership has resulted in a parallel demand for quality auto parts. National manufacturers are striving to meet this demand, but the market also relies imports of auto parts from countries like China, Japan, and South Korea. The standard of imported auto parts fluctuates, and there is a growing awareness among consumers about the importance of using genuine and reliable parts to ensure vehicle safety.
